WebThe tax credit is based on salaries and wages paid to a student in a co-operative education work placement. Corporations can claim 25 per cent of eligible expenditures (30 per cent for small businesses). The maximum credit for each work placement is $3,000.

WebThese include payments made to any of the following individuals or institutions: caregivers providing child care services. day nursery schools and daycare centres. educational … Web5 de jan. de 2024 · Quick facts about the Small Businesses Air Quality Improvement Tax Credit. As we examine the newly proposed tax credit, these basic points are worth outlining: The credit rate is 25% of qualifying expenditures to a maximum of $10,000 in qualifying expenditures, or a $2,500 tax credit, per eligible location. Each eligible entity …

Web23 de ago. de 2024 · When filing your federal income tax, you can typically claim eligible donations up to 75% of your yearly net income. The federal charitable tax-credit rate since 2016 is 15% for the first $200 donated. Any amount over $200 qualifies for a 29% tax-credit rate.
